Vangudi[வங்குடி] is a village in the Udayarpalayam taluk of Ariyalur district, Tamil Nadu, India. It is located 235 km away from Chennai.
Demographics
As per the 2001 census, Vangudi had a total population of 4795 with 2419 males and 2376 females.[1]
